    Hi guys,
    I feel very confused about the height blend of the layeredLit material.
    It looks like the parametrization of the height maps is good for nothing. And everything is controlled by the height transition slider.
    Which doesn't make sense to me. The way I see it, the parametrization should be a remapping range in real world values.
    eg:
    if layer1 is going from -50 cm to 50 cm, and layer2 from -50 to 0, layer 2 should only be seen in the depth of layer1.
    And if layer2 if remapped from -100 to -50, it should even not be seen.

    But obviously i'm wrong.

    Can someone explain to me how it works?

    If it can help someone. I found out that editing materials used as layers in the main layeredLit works.

    If i change values (only for height) in the layeredLit directly, nothing happens. But if I edit values in one of the material then re apply it in the layeredLit it works.
    Not handy though...
